IN NO EVENT SHALL THE COPYRIGHT # HOLDER OR CONTRIBUTORS BE LIABLE FOR ANY DIRECT, INDIRECT, INCIDENTAL, # SPECIAL, EXEMPLARY, OR CONSEQUENTIAL DAMAGES (INCLUDING, BUT NOT # LIMITED TO, PROCUREMENT OF SUBSTITUTE GOODS OR SERVICES; LOSS OF USE, # DATA, OR PROFITS; OR BUSINESS INTERRUPTION) HOWEVER CAUSED AND ON ANY # THEORY OF LIABILITY, WHETHER IN CONTRACT, STRICT LIABILITY, OR TORT # (INCLUDING NEGLIGENCE OR OTHERWISE) ARISING IN ANY WAY OUT OF THE USE # OF THIS SOFTWARE, EVEN IF ADVISED OF THE POSSIBILITY OF SUCH DAMAGE. #============================================================================= ######### # Local rewrite of the protobuf support in cmake. # # Supports cross-module protobuf dependencies and protobufs inside # packages much better than the one built into cmake. ######### # # Locate and configure the Google Protocol Buffers library. # Defines the following variables: # # PROTOBUF_INCLUDE_DIR - the include directory for protocol buffers # PROTOBUF_SHARED_LIBRARY - path to protobuf's shared library # PROTOBUF_STATIC_LIBRARY - path to protobuf's static library # PROTOBUF_PROTOC_SHARED_LIBRARY - path to protoc's shared library # PROTOBUF_PROTOC_STATIC_LIBRARY - path to protoc's static library # PROTOBUF_PROTOC_EXECUTABLE - the protoc compiler # PROTOBUF_FOUND - whether the Protocol Buffers library has been found # # ==================================================================== # Example: # # find_package(Protobuf REQUIRED) # include_directories(${PROTOBUF_INCLUDE_DIR}) # # include_directories(${CMAKE_CURRENT_BINARY_DIR}) # PROTOBUF_GENERATE_CPP(PROTO_SRCS PROTO_HDRS PROTO_TGTS # [SOURCE_ROOT <root from which source is found>] # [BINARY_ROOT <root into which binaries are built>] # PROTO_FILES foo.proto) # add_executable(bar bar.cc ${PROTO_SRCS} ${PROTO_HDRS}) # target_link_libraries(bar ${PROTOBUF_SHARED_LIBRARY}) # # NOTE: You may need to link against pthreads, depending # on the platform. # ==================================================================== # # PROTOBUF_GENERATE_CPP (public function) # SRCS = Variable to define with autogenerated # source files # HDRS = Variable to define with autogenerated # header files # TGTS = Variable to define with autogenerated # custom targets; if SRCS/HDRS need to be used in multiple # libraries, those libraries should depend on these targets # in order to "serialize" the protoc invocations # ==================================================================== function(PROTOBUF_GENERATE_CPP SRCS HDRS TGTS) if(NOT ARGN) message(SEND_ERROR "Error: PROTOBUF_GENERATE_CPP() called without any proto files") return() endif(NOT ARGN) set(options) set(one_value_args SOURCE_ROOT BINARY_ROOT) set(multi_value_args EXTRA_PROTO_PATHS PROTO_FILES) cmake_parse_arguments(ARG "${options}" "${one_value_args}" "${multi_value_args}" ${ARGN}) if(ARG_UNPARSED_ARGUMENTS) message(SEND_ERROR "Error: unrecognized arguments: ${ARG_UNPARSED_ARGUMENTS}") endif() set(${SRCS}) set(${HDRS}) set(${TGTS}) set(EXTRA_PROTO_PATH_ARGS) foreach(PP ${ARG_EXTRA_PROTO_PATHS}) set(EXTRA_PROTO_PATH_ARGS ${EXTRA_PROTO_PATH_ARGS} --proto_path ${PP}) endforeach() if("${ARG_SOURCE_ROOT}" STREQUAL "") SET(ARG_SOURCE_ROOT "${CMAKE_CURRENT_SOURCE_DIR}") endif() GET_FILENAME_COMPONENT(ARG_SOURCE_ROOT ${ARG_SOURCE_ROOT} ABSOLUTE) if("${ARG_BINARY_ROOT}" STREQUAL "") SET(ARG_BINARY_ROOT "${CMAKE_CURRENT_BINARY_DIR}") endif() GET_FILENAME_COMPONENT(ARG_BINARY_ROOT ${ARG_BINARY_ROOT} ABSOLUTE) foreach(FIL ${ARG_PROTO_FILES}) get_filename_component(ABS_FIL ${FIL} ABSOLUTE) get_filename_component(FIL_WE ${FIL} NAME_WE) # Ensure that the protobuf file is within the source root. # This is a requirement of protoc. FILE(RELATIVE_PATH PROTO_REL_TO_ROOT "${ARG_SOURCE_ROOT}" "${ABS_FIL}") GET_FILENAME_COMPONENT(REL_DIR "${PROTO_REL_TO_ROOT}" PATH) if(NOT REL_DIR STREQUAL "") SET(REL_DIR "${REL_DIR}/") endif() set(PROTO_CC_OUT "${ARG_BINARY_ROOT}/${REL_DIR}${FIL_WE}.pb.cc") set(PROTO_H_OUT "${ARG_BINARY_ROOT}/${REL_DIR}${FIL_WE}.pb.h") list(APPEND ${SRCS} "${PROTO_CC_OUT}") list(APPEND ${HDRS} "${PROTO_H_OUT}") add_custom_command( OUTPUT "${PROTO_CC_OUT}" "${PROTO_H_OUT}" COMMAND ${PROTOBUF_PROTOC_EXECUTABLE} ARGS --plugin $<TARGET_FILE:protoc-gen-insertions> --cpp_out ${ARG_BINARY_ROOT} --insertions_out ${ARG_BINARY_ROOT} --proto_path ${ARG_SOURCE_ROOT} # Used to find built-in .proto files (e.g. FileDescriptorProto) --proto_path ${PROTOBUF_INCLUDE_DIR} ${EXTRA_PROTO_PATH_ARGS} ${ABS_FIL} DEPENDS ${ABS_FIL} protoc-gen-insertions COMMENT "Running C++ protocol buffer compiler on ${FIL}" VERBATIM ) # This custom target enforces that there's just one invocation of protoc # when there are multiple consumers of the generated files. The target name # must be unique; adding parts of the filename helps ensure this. string(MAKE_C_IDENTIFIER "${REL_DIR}${FIL}" TGT_NAME) add_custom_target(${TGT_NAME} DEPENDS "${PROTO_CC_OUT}" "${PROTO_H_OUT}") list(APPEND ${TGTS} "${TGT_NAME}") endforeach() set_source_files_properties(${${SRCS}} ${${HDRS}} PROPERTIES GENERATED TRUE) set(${SRCS} ${${SRCS}} PARENT_SCOPE) set(${HDRS} ${${HDRS}} PARENT_SCOPE) set(${TGTS} ${${TGTS}} PARENT_SCOPE) # The 'pb-gen' is a high-level target in $KUDU_ROOT/CMakeLists.txt to # process protobuf definitions and generate corresponding header/source files. add_dependencies(pb-gen ${${TGTS}}) endfunction() find_path(PROTOBUF_INCLUDE_DIR google/protobuf/service.h NO_CMAKE_SYSTEM_PATH NO_SYSTEM_ENVIRONMENT_PATH) find_library(PROTOBUF_SHARED_LIBRARY protobuf DOC "The Google Protocol Buffers Library" NO_CMAKE_SYSTEM_PATH NO_SYSTEM_ENVIRONMENT_PATH) find_library(PROTOBUF_STATIC_LIBRARY libprotobuf.a DOC "Static version of the Google Protocol Buffers Library" NO_CMAKE_SYSTEM_PATH NO_SYSTEM_ENVIRONMENT_PATH) find_library(PROTOBUF_PROTOC_SHARED_LIBRARY protoc DOC "The Google Protocol Buffers Compiler Library" NO_CMAKE_SYSTEM_PATH NO_SYSTEM_ENVIRONMENT_PATH) find_library(PROTOBUF_PROTOC_STATIC_LIBRARY libprotoc.a DOC "Static version of the Google Protocol Buffers Compiler Library" NO_CMAKE_SYSTEM_PATH NO_SYSTEM_ENVIRONMENT_PATH) find_program(PROTOBUF_PROTOC_EXECUTABLE protoc DOC "The Google Protocol Buffers Compiler" NO_CMAKE_SYSTEM_PATH NO_SYSTEM_ENVIRONMENT_PATH) include(FindPackageHandleStandardArgs) find_package_handle_standard_args(Protobuf REQUIRED_VARS PROTOBUF_SHARED_LIBRARY PROTOBUF_STATIC_LIBRARY PROTOBUF_PROTOC_SHARED_LIBRARY PROTOBUF_PROTOC_STATIC_LIBRARY PROTOBUF_INCLUDE_DIR PROTOBUF_PROTOC_EXECUTABLE)
